Catfish Products - recalled due to being produced without Benefit of Inspection

The FSIS announced the recall of approximately 46,804 pounds of Siluriformes fish (catfish) by Otten’s Seafood Inc. because the products were produced, packed, and distributed without the benefit of federal inspection. There have been no confirmed reports of adverse reactions due to consumption of these products.The recalled products are:
- 30-lb. plastic bags and cardboard boxes containing “IQF Frozen Catfish Steaks Net Weight 30.00 LB” and have a shelf-life of one year.
- 30-lb. plastic bags and cardboard boxes containing “40 + Oz Fresh Catfish Whole Net Weight 30.00 LB” and have a shelf-life of one week if not frozen.
These items were produced from Jan. 25, 2021, through May 21, 2021, and were shipped to wholesale and retail locations in Illinois and Indiana.
FSIS is concerned that some products may be in consumers’ refrigerators or freezers. If you have the recalled products in your home, please throw them away or returned them to the place of purchase.
